How they compare

Lithuania currently reports 1.4% against 1.1% in Iceland, a difference of 0.3%.

That makes Lithuania's figure about 1.2 times Iceland's.

The two have swapped places 5 times across 41 shared years of data; in 1985 it was Iceland ahead.

Iceland ranks 59th and Lithuania ranks 58th of 78 countries.

Across the 5 decades both report, Iceland averaged higher in 3 and Lithuania in 2.

Head to head by decade

Decade Iceland Lithuania Difference Ahead
1980s 5.8% 5.8% 0.0% Iceland
1990s 3.9% 3.2% 0.7% Iceland
2000s 2.9% 2.1% 0.8% Iceland
2010s 1.6% 3.9% 2.3% Lithuania
2020s 1.3% 2.5% 1.1% Lithuania

Averages of every year both report within each decade.
